Transaction ddc0661dd6529e27cbbc28da6832f132fb70ff17177c7e342c3fdec21eae4f6f

2 Input
2 Outputs
  • ddc0661dd6529e27cbbc28da6832f132fb70ff17177c7e342c3fdec21eae4f6f:0
  • value  5000000
    address  1MLzMrsA7HAQU64wzFUHevBzd4urE32QwA
  • ddc0661dd6529e27cbbc28da6832f132fb70ff17177c7e342c3fdec21eae4f6f:1
  • value  5998103
    address  3DVuw1f4MniGDV3YuxcgG6wHkHmCRZVb3K